Home MenuMeet Your Newly Elected City Council Members
On Tuesday, March 10, 2026, the City of Tempe held a Primary Election to nominate and/or elect candidates for three City Council seats. Candidate Arlene Chin received more votes than the required majority threshold and was declared re-elected to office, effective as of the May 19, 2026, General Election.
On Tuesday, May 19, 2026, the City of Tempe held a General Election for the remaining two City Council seats. Candidates Bobby Nichols and Brooke St. George received the highest number of votes cast and were declared elected to the office of City Councilmember.
On March 26, the City Council adopted Resolution No. R2026.30 declaring the canvass of the March 10 Primary Election results. On June 4, the City Council adopted Resolution No. R2026.57 declaring the canvass of the May 19 General Election results.
The terms of office for Councilmembers-elect Arlene Chin, Bobby Nichols, and Brooke St. George will commence at the July 1 Regular Council Meeting.
